NBJ expands lines in wholesale business drive

tony-copping

NBJ UK has launched a revamped London Markets division aimed at expanding and diversifying its wholesale business.

The specialist commercial broker said it will now offer additional services for liability, contractors and credit insurance, as well as its traditional motor risks specialism.

NBJ added the move followed its partnership with IAG-owned Barnett & Barnett last year.

The initiative will be led by newly-appointed London Markets director, Tony Copping, who has joined from Ropner Insurance Brokers.

Broking profits fall at Saga

Underlying profit before tax in Saga’s insurance broking arm fell to £39.8m for the year ended 31 January 2024, compared with £71.5m in the previous period.
